Wholly Undead 135 No More Blood left to Bleed

"Yes, my King."

"How did you get back from Zitergall, so quickly?" The King asked, uncertainly.

"Many... Many undead steeds were sacrificed. I have returned as Obsignator Jacob, Messenger of the God-King of Deagoth." Jacob spoke still bended on knee.

"What!?" The King yelled... He had just said there were no gods here, and then this loser rolled into his hall.

"OOooOoooh?" A seductive sound nipped at all the minds of the undead present, even though that were not male...

A few steps forward, and the Princess leaned down to look at Jacobs face, her cleavage in full view of Jacob, "Obsignator Jacob is it? Tell me about your God-King."

Jacob swallowed hard looking at the amble flesh in front of him, though he was a geist that preferred skeletal women, he couldn't help himself from admiring the view.

He then looked to the King. The King then turned and seated himself and nodded to Jacob. Jacob then told everything that happened in Zitergall. The war, the battles, who died, who went missing, the appearance of the God-King, his words, and finally... The God-King's wrath."

"Nonsense!" A zombie Official of the court stood out to reprimand Jacob.

"We seen him in the sky, but that doesn't make him a god! At best it was a simple light show!" The Official said with a smug smile.

Princess Violet caught sight of the blood princess' expression... She would not intervene on this stupid Officials behalf. Who told him to butt in at the wrong time?

Eris stood up to look at this Official, and spoke to him directly, disregarding the King completely, "What did you say about my god?"

Black sweat beaded up on the zombie Officials brow, as he wondered why this visitor acted out in the King's royal hall.

"You still have blood in your body, don't you?" The princess asked in a strange way, as she tilted her head to smile widely.

Her hands danced in the air as she muttered words the others couldn't understand, and soon the Official that mouthed off... stopped speaking.

The court watched, as his black blood seeped from his skin. It didn't drip onto the floor, but cover ever centimeter of the Official, even his clothes. The princess made an open hand, as she waved to herself. The stiff black bloody official lifted into the air, and over to her.

She looked around from left to right, and then back to the King, "Your servant has blasphemy my god."

Princess Eris made a fist, and the black blood membrane holding the Official collapse inward with an otherworldly sound. A sound rustling, cracking, grinding, and wretch snapping, until a smooth shiny ball of black blood remained in the air.

With a wave of her hands, the black ball of blood fell to the ground, as it landed dully. It was solid and rolled slightly in place a few steps behind her.

"No one... Blasphemies my god." A crazy murderous look flashed in Eris's eyes, as she looked around this shit hole.


Princess Eris hunched, and quickly pulled out a napkin and coughed a few times into it. She looked down to see that her blood had turned a slight pink color. No longer the vibrant red it was days ago...

[Soon, I won't last... I gave to much blood.] Eris thought to herself, as she smiled again.

With this same smile, she put her napkin back, as she turned to face Jacob.

"Obsignator Jacob, would you be so kind as to guide me to your god." Princess Eris looked deeply at Jacob, as Jacob seen the swirls of madness and lust in her eyes... He shivered without thinking.

"Of-Of course!"

"HOLD IT!" The King of Jakahn rose again.

"It will take days to leave here to go to... Deagoth. We can see you are weak and need rest. Stay here and rest. We will work on remedies for your illness. We can do much to benefit each other." The King had totally disregarded his servant that was crushed into a blood ball.

The princess tilted her head again as she looked at the King, then to Princess Violet. Princess Violet was about to speak up, when Eris spoke first, "Obsignator."

"Y-yes, your highness." Even Jacob knew to address this woman with respect, as he lowered his eyes. Looking at her gave him hot feelings, he wished he didn't have...

"How far is it to where my god resides?"

"The God-King stays within the Holy Kingdom of Deagoth, in his Capital City of Saigunrai. It would take us two months to get there by caravan... Ah, two weeks if it was one person sacrificing their steeds to continuously run.

"Two months? I don't have time for two months... Say, Obsignator... Is Jakahn actually enemies with the God-King."

All gazes in the room fell to Jacob... Everyone that wasn't stupid knew his next words would spark this crazy woman if spoken wrong... Worst of all the King couldn't figure out how strong of a Cultivator she was... While everyone waited for this moment, Princess Violet motioned her father, the King.

The King descended from his Throne, and they both left through a secret door, as no one noticed them, as everyone was focused on Jacob.

Jacob looked to the throne to see it vacant... He was abandoned... Then he would abandon Jakahn!

"YES, PRINCESS! THESE PEOPLE DO NOT GIVE FAITH TO THE GOD-KING! YOU HEARD THE DISRESPECT EARILER OUT OF THESE WIND BAG OFFICALS!" Jacob roared. He hated these old fucks, the Officials of Jakahn. Many times, he could fix issues with a bit of military power, but they were too focused on profit and the ear of the King to allow him.

"They have?!?"

"GREAT!" The princess clapped her hands together, as she looked to her captain who had been silent this entire time.

"Good Captain, please create the Blood Bat Seal here, we have enough blood with these zombies... The skeletal ones should just be destroyed."

"You heard the princess, boys! Kill'em all and let the Creator sort'em out!" A wide smile formed on all the crewmen at this word. These Vampires had been cooped up on a ship for a while... They would enjoy bloodshed again, as they jumped into the groups of Officials like wolfs in a flock of sheep. Each tearing the Officials apart, leaving others with sliced throats to spill messy black blood on the red carpet of the Royal hall... The skeletal undead were dismantled limb from limb, as their screams etched into the minds of the remaining undead that fled.

Captain Fairfield took his side sword, and ripped the robe from a dead Official, and created a make shift brush. The other crew me pulled back the red Carpet to give plenty of room on the marble floor.

The Captain began to draw elaborate runes, sigils, and summoning circles within each circle.

Jacob watched in horror as his countrymen were wholesale slaughtered... They were slaughtered not as warriors... But as live stock. It made him feel sick in his soul, but some strange feeling of happiness budded as well, seeing those bastards meet true death. He came to the side of the princess and kneeled again. He didn't dare to offend this woman, while the woman in question, Princess Eris cough again into her napkin.

[It's getting paler in color...] She thought.

"How much longer before We can summon the Blood Bats?"

"I'm almost done... With the blood of these cattle, I'd say We can have it done in a few hours. They won't be as strong as the blood slaves, but black blood is better than no blood."

"Is it an issue of quantity or quality?"

"Even if We took a million zombies to make this, it's not going to help. Black Blood just isn't going to cut it. We need blood with life."

Watching the Captain back off from the giant runescape made on the floor, he nodded in satisfaction at his work. This was his best work yet!

The princess watched, as the fallen zombies were dragged over, and their necks spilling blood into the runescape. Those that weren't bleeding, were nicked in the throat where the carotid artery descends into the body, causing the blood to spill faster, like pigs being drained of blood for meat, as the zombie bodies were through to the side, discarded like trash.

The princess remained silent, as she took a few steps forward, and took his ceremonial dagger, and sliced her wrist. She turned palm over, as the Captain yelled behind her, "NOOOOOOOO! PLEASE, CREATOR, NO!"

She squeezed her hands a few times, but nothing came out. In anger, she slashed three more times, and used her other hand to squeeze around her arm, until a few drops of bright crimson blood dripped into the maroon colored runes on the floor shined with a baleful light.

Satisfied, she took a few steps back, but she stumbled to fall, as the captain held her up, and steadied her on her feet.

The captain wanted to say something, but what was done was done, so he remained silent.

Eris licked the wounds on her arms and savored the filling of the cuts she had made. It would take days for these to heal with her current condition, maybe a month...

The crimson blood worked its way within the black mass of blood... The runes were set, and the ritual began... Soon, the legendary Blood Bats of Alucard would ride north to Deagoth... To her god.

"My god... Save your pet." Eris coughed into her napkin, but this time... It was only clear plasma.
